SF dining destination since 1999 with excellent food plus foreign and indie films screened on a large wall of the outdoor covered patio. Dinner and brunch.
**Closed 2-5pm Sat**

Diners return again and again to this long-beloved magical spot with consistently excellent food and vibe. By husband/wife duo with Bay Area pedigree from Zuni Cafe & Chez Panisse.

Both dinner and weekend brunch are not-to-miss, with ever-changing menus per the availability of organic, seasonal produce, meat and fish. The oyster bar has a good selection of local & West Coast oysters, plus shellfish and sustainable caviar.

Don’t miss house-cured local sardines or anchovies on the side. Also made in house: charcuterie, burratta, cultured butter, and more.

The atmosphere is industrial chic with a lively, warm vibe thanks to the outdoor firepit, indoor fireplace, and open kitchen. Art is prominently displayed. Inside features avant-garde post-World War II Polish movie posters, and outside boasts a stunning colorful mural by artist Jet Martinez.
